Incident Summary
Recently, two nurses in Sydney were suspended for making threats against an Israeli man in a viral video. Caught on a website named Chatrouletka, they allegedly claimed to have harmed Jewish patients in their care.
Official Reactions
Australia’s Department of Health and Aged Care announced their immediate suspension, affirming a strict stand against discrimination. The country’s Standing Prime Minister, Anthony Albanese, referred the case for police investigation.
